> +if ! ethtool --json -k $NSIM_NETDEV > /dev/null 2>&1; then

I guess it's improving the situation, but I've got a system with an
ethtool that accepts the --json argument, but silently ignores it for
 -k (ie `ethtool --json -k $DEV` succeeds but doesn't produce a json
output), which will still cause the test to fail later.
